Not just according to us at Sympatia — among all production halls, the clear winner is our charming Slovene: The Brnik 2 production hall.

If you haven’t seen it in person yet, it stands right next to Ljubljana International Airport.
Production halls have been, are, and will remain an essential part of our lives because they make the goods we use every day. That’s why it’s so important they are energyselfsufficient, ecofriendly and visually attractive — they occupy a significant share of public space and shape the surrounding environment.

When we planned Brnik 2, we made sure the building would have exceptional architectural design. It’s not just “a Gray industrial box.” Spatially and technologically, it ranks among the best and most modern production halls in Europe. Heating and cooling are provided primarily by heat pumps, the roof hosts a photovoltaic plant with a total installed capacity of 1.7 MW, and the project has earned green certifications (BREEAM/LEED).
Exactly one year ago we officially handed it over to Bosch Rexroth d.o.o. Slovenia, part of the multinational Bosch Rexroth group operating in engineering and electronics. At the handover, their representatives praised not only the building’s sustainability and attractive appearance, but also its strategic location close to the international airport, motorways, rail links and the Rijeka Gateway port — as well as Slovenia’s safe business environment thanks to EU, NATO and eurozone membership.
